There are so many fabulous TRs on Africa that I thought in the spirit of not boring people to death with our more mundane trip that I would instead only report on the things that others may not have included. Of course, no southern Africa TR would be complete without at least a smattering of the wonderful wildlife we saw on our trip, so I will post some of those pics as well.
To put the trip in perspective, this is not a live TR; we returned home yesterday, so it is all in the past as they say.
Mr LtL and I rather enjoy train travel and after our E&OE Thailand to Singapore jaunt last December, Rovos Rail in South Africa caught our eye.
The overall itinerary was:
26 August – CBR – SYD (on Murrays coaches - cheap and easy) – overnight Rydges Airport Hotel
27 August – SYD – JNB – QF63 - J – overnight Intercontinental OR Tambo International Airport
28 August – JMB – VFA – BA6285 (operated by Comair) – J – 2 nights at Zambezi Sun Hotel, Livingstone
30 August – Rovos Rail – Victoria Falls to Pretoria, 3 nights, 1 night Intercontinental OR Tambo International Airport again. Daughter, Dr LtL joined us here
3 September – Federal Air shuttle to Ngala Safari Lodge in Timbavati
6 September – shuttle again to Exeter River Lodge in Sabi Sand reserve
10 September – Federal Air back to JNB. 2 nights Intercontinental Sandton, though Dr LtL flew straight back
12 September – JNB – SYD – QF 64 – J, SYD – CBR – QF1525 – Y
All bookings except for the hotel in Livingstone were made directly with the supplier. Sun Hotels seemed to have a very complicated booking engine so I used Booking.com for the Zambezi Sun.
